About Bruce D. Lindsay
Bruce D. Lindsay is a scholar working on Cardiology and Cardiovascular Medicine, Medical Laboratory Technology and Music, having authored 157 papers that have together received 8.2k indexed citations. Recurring topics across this work include Cardiac Arrhythmias and Treatments (111 papers), Atrial Fibrillation Management and Outcomes (73 papers) and Cardiac pacing and defibrillation studies (63 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(7.2k citations), Radiology, Nuclear Medicine and Imaging (998 citations) and Internal Medicine (139 citations). Bruce D. Lindsay has collaborated with scholars based in United States, United Kingdom and Australia. Frequent co-authors include Michael Cain, James L. Cox, Richard B. Schuessler, Oussama M. Wazni, John P. Boineau, Peter B. Corr, Andrea M. Russo, Mitchell N. Faddis, Thomas E. Canavan and Constance Stone. Their work appears in journals such as New England Journal of Medicine, JAMA and Circulation.
